要查看Java進程的內存占用情況,可以使用以下命令:
top -p <java進程ID>
在top命令的輸出中,可以查看到Java進程的內存占用情況,包括物理內存(RES)和虛擬內存(VIRT)。
ps -p <java進程ID> -o rss,vsize
這個命令會輸出Java進程的物理內存(rss)和虛擬內存(vsize)。
jstat -gc <java進程ID>
這個命令會輸出Java進程的堆內存使用情況,包括Eden Space、Survivor Space、Old Gen等。
jmap -heap <java進程ID>
這個命令會輸出Java進程的堆內存使用情況,包括堆大小、已使用大小、GC算法等。
請注意,上述命令中的<java進程ID>
需要替換為實際的Java進程ID。可以使用ps命令或者jps命令來查看Java進程的ID。